6000 Baht Thai Alphabet
2526 (1984) year| Gold | 15 g | 26 mm |
| Issuer | Thailand |
|---|---|
| King | Bhumibol Adulyadej (Rama IX) (1946-2016) |
| Type | Non-circulating coin |
| Year | 2526 (1984) |
| Calendar | Thai |
| Value | 6000 Bahts (6000 บาท) 6000 THB = USD 179 |
| Currency | Baht (1897-date) |
| Composition | Gold |
| Weight | 15 g |
| Diameter | 26 mm |
| Shape | Round |
| Technique | Milled |
| Updated | 2024-10-08 |
| Numista | N#362210 |
